]> granicus.if.org Git - python/commitdiff
#3614: Correct a typo in xmlrpc.client.
authorAmaury Forgeot d'Arc <amauryfa@gmail.com>
Wed, 20 Aug 2008 21:35:50 +0000 (21:35 +0000)
committerAmaury Forgeot d'Arc <amauryfa@gmail.com>
Wed, 20 Aug 2008 21:35:50 +0000 (21:35 +0000)
Lib/xmlrpc/client.py
Misc/NEWS

index 121fedf7f08e5bd669f8829a85e76794a6c10411..d18efce4c101aa856c6b3cdec23891c9d52b6b41 100644 (file)
@@ -1203,7 +1203,7 @@ class Transport:
         headers = {}
         if extra_headers:
             for key, val in extra_headers:
-                header[key] = val
+                headers[key] = val
         headers["Content-Type"] = "text/xml"
         headers["User-Agent"] = self.user_agent
         connection.request("POST", handler, request_body, headers)
@@ -1271,7 +1271,7 @@ class SafeTransport(Transport):
         headers = {}
         if extra_headers:
             for key, val in extra_headers:
-                header[key] = val
+                headers[key] = val
         headers["Content-Type"] = "text/xml"
         headers["User-Agent"] = self.user_agent
         connection.request("POST", handler, request_body, headers)
index 3d10f6ee55cac8927e11f0d4998b9c17c970f0ca..9c521f226ee3ae8ad6f1fa8c4b1d9487e7c49dc9 100644 (file)
--- a/Misc/NEWS
+++ b/Misc/NEWS
@@ -46,6 +46,9 @@ Core and Builtins
 Library
 -------
 
+- Issue #3614: Corrected a typo in xmlrpc.client, leading to a NameError
+  "global name 'header' is not defined".
+
 - Issue #2834: update the regular expression library to match the unicode
   standards of py3k. In other words, mixing bytes and unicode strings
   (be it as pattern, search string or replacement string) raises a TypeError.